Our treatment plans are not a pick-and-choose menu. Your provider will recommend the care necessary to properly diagnose and treat your dental needs, and your costs will be based on that recommended plan.
Patients always have the right to decline any or all recommended treatment. However, we will not deviate from appropriate comprehensive care or the standard of care, including obtaining all necessary diagnostic information. If recommended care is declined, we may be unable to proceed with treatment and may recommend seeking care from another practice that better aligns with your needs.
Listed fees are office rates and are subject to change based on diagnostic or treatment needs, insurance coverage, and available payment or financing options. We will provide a treatment estimate based on these factors before treatment begins.
Single Extraction: $250 - $445
Single Crown: $1649 - $2094
Invisalign: $5,600 or if you choose to pay in cash $4,200
One EIC (extraction implant and implant crown): $4,050
Three Unit Bridge: $5,193
Three Unit Implant: $9,393
One Full Arch Restoration: $21,000 or $18,000 if paying in cash
Two Full Arch Restoration: $42,000 or if you are paying in cash $36,000

It is the responsibility of the patient to verify they have active coverage and understand their specific policy. Not all dental policies under the listed accepted carriers will have benefits while seen at the office.
The patient should always call the ‘Member Number’ on the back of their insurance card to verify acceptance, active coverage, and ask any clarifying questions.
We bill ALL insurance carriers on the patients behalf.
It is always recommended to call your insurance carrier to fully understand your coverage and we are here to help!

Your Maximum and deductible.
The maximum is the dollar amount your insurance can put toward your treatment. the deductible is the dollar amount insurance deems YOU are responsible for with services. (This can be annually or ‘lifetime’ - onetime payment)
